Abstract

The utility model discloses a novel liquid cooling motor casing, which comprises a casing main body, wherein a radiating fin is fixedly arranged on the surface of the casing main body, a radiating through hole is arranged on one side of the radiating fin, a cooling liquid inlet is arranged on one side of the top of the casing main body, a cooling liquid outlet is arranged on the other side of the top of the casing main body, a cooling cavity is arranged on the inner side of the casing main body, and a damping spring is arranged on one side of the cooling cavity; this novel liquid cooling motor casing is through setting up coolant liquid import and coolant liquid export and cooling cavity, the area of contact on coolant liquid and motor surface has been increased, the heat that produces the motor during operation that can be fine cools off, through fin and heat dissipation through-hole, make the radiating effect of motor better, through setting up quick-witted inner shell and damping spring, the vibrations that can produce the motor during operation are cushioned, thereby the motor has been prevented because vibrations have also reduced the propagation of noise when leading to each part to connect not hard up problem.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-3, in this embodiment: the utility model provides a novel liquid cooling motor casing, includes casing main part 1, and casing main part 1's fixed surface is provided with fin 3, and one side of fin 3 is provided with heat dissipation through-hole 4, and one side at casing main part 1 top is provided with coolant liquid import 5, and the opposite side at casing main part 1 top is provided with coolant liquid export 7, and cooling chamber 8 has been seted up to casing main part 1's inboard, and one side of cooling chamber 8 is provided with damping spring 6, and damping spring 6's inboard is provided with organic shell 2.
In the embodiment, the inner side wall of the machine shell main body 1 is fixedly connected with one end of the damping spring 6, so that vibration generated when the motor works can be buffered conveniently, the problem that all parts of the motor are connected and loosened due to vibration is prevented, and noise transmission is reduced; the other end of the damping spring 6 is fixedly connected with the outer side of the inner shell 2, so that the structure is more reasonable; the bottom end of the cooling liquid inlet 5 is fixedly communicated with one side of the top of the cooling chamber 8, so that cooling liquid can enter conveniently, and heat generated when the motor works is cooled; the bottom end of the cooling liquid outlet 7 is fixedly communicated with the other side of the top of the cooling chamber 8, so that the cooling liquid can flow out conveniently and the use is more convenient; the quantity of fin 3 is the multiunit, and fin 3 is made by the copper product, makes the radiating effect of motor better to a certain extent.
The utility model discloses a theory of operation and use flow: when using this liquid cooling motor casing, with the coolant liquid through coolant liquid import 5 pour into the cooling chamber 8 of casing main part 1 can, through coolant liquid import 5 and coolant liquid export 7 and cooling chamber 8, the area of contact on coolant liquid and motor surface has been increased, the heat that produces the motor during operation that can be fine cools off, through fin 3 and heat dissipation through-hole 4, make the radiating effect of motor better, through inner shell 2 and damping spring 6, can cushion the vibrations that the motor during operation produced, thereby prevented that the motor also reduced the propagation of noise when vibrations lead to each part to connect not hard up problem.
